Blocking assets in Ukraine and deprivation of state awards
In May 2025, Petro Poroshenko demands to declare illegal the decree on personal indefinite sanctions against him, signed in February by Ukrainian President Zelensky.
The restrictions were imposed amid allegations of treason and collusion with other major politicians and businessmen, as well as with the Russian authorities, which allegedly led to significant economic losses. All Poroshenko's assets were blocked, and he was also deprived of state awards.
At the same time, Zelensky allowed the accused to pay off and left a loophole to lift the sanctions - if Poroshenko and his comrades-in-arms cover the Ukrainian budget deficit of several billion hryvnias in the fund to support the Armed Forces of Ukraine.
In response to restrictive measures in the European Solidarity party, the head of which is Poroshenko, announced attempts to clean up the country's political field on the eve of the presidential election. In addition, a petition was sent to the reception of the President's Office in defense of Poroshenko, signed by more than 100 thousand people.
